Struct PostgresConnectionManager

Source
pub struct PostgresConnectionManager<T>
where T: 'static + MakeTlsConnect<Socket> + Clone + Send + Sync,
{ /* private fields */ }
Expand description

A ManageConnection for tokio_postgres::Connections.

Implementations§

Source§

impl<T> PostgresConnectionManager<T>
where T: 'static + MakeTlsConnect<Socket> + Clone + Send + Sync,

Source

pub fn new(config: Config, make_tls_connect: T) -> Self

Create a new PostgresConnectionManager.

Source§

impl<T> ManageConnection for PostgresConnectionManager<T>
where T: 'static + MakeTlsConnect<Socket> + Clone + Send + Sync, T::Stream: Send + Sync, T::TlsConnect: Send, <T::TlsConnect as TlsConnect<Socket>>::Future: Send,

Source§

type Connection = AsyncConnection

The connection type this manager deals with.
Source§

type Error = Error

The error type returned by Connections.
Source§

fn connect<'life0, 'async_trait>( &'life0 self, ) ->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= Result<Self::Connection, Error<Self::Error>>> + Send + 'async_trait>>
where Self: 'async_trait, 'life0: 'async_trait,

Attempts to create a new connection. Read more
Source§

fn is_valid<'life0, 'life1, 'async_trait>( &'life0 self, conn: &'life1 mut Self::Connection, ) ->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= Result<(), Error<Self::Error>>> + Send + 'async_trait>>
where Self: 'async_trait, 'life0: 'async_trait, 'life1: 'async_trait,

Determines if the connection is still connected to the database. Read more
Source§

fn has_broken(&self, conn: &mut Self::Connection) -> bool

Quick check to determine if the connection has broken
Source§

fn timed_out(&self) -> Error<Self::Error>

Produce an error representing a connection timeout.
